The meaning of Haralambi

Haralambi is a masculine name of Bulgarian origin that means joyful and bright. Derived from the Greek words 'chara' meaning joy and 'lambos' meaning brightness or shining, this name conveys a sense of happiness and positivity, often associated with light and joyfulness. It holds cultural and religious significance, particularly in Eastern Orthodox Christianity, as it is linked to Saint Haralambos.

Origin of Haralambi

The name Haralambi is of Bulgarian origin, derived from the Greek name Haralambos. It is associated with Saint Haralambos, a Christian martyr revered in Eastern Orthodox Christianity. The name has been historically popular in Bulgaria and surrounding regions, reflecting cultural and religious significance.
